Operations Specialist Jobs in Oklahoma: Frequently Asked Questions

Which companies sponsor visas for operations specialists in Oklahoma?

Energy sector employers are among the most active sponsors for operations specialist roles in Oklahoma. Williams Companies and ONEOK in Tulsa hire for pipeline and midstream operations coordination. In Oklahoma City, Devon Energy and Paycom sponsor operations roles tied to corporate functions. Aerospace supplier Spirit AeroSystems in Tulsa also hires operations specialists for manufacturing support and logistics coordination.

Which visa types are most common for operations specialist roles in Oklahoma?

The H-1B visa is the most common visa for operations specialists in Oklahoma, provided the role requires at least a bachelor's degree in a specific field such as business administration, industrial engineering, or supply chain management. Some positions qualify for TN visa status for Canadian and Mexican nationals under business or industrial engineer categories. L-1B visas apply when a multinational employer transfers a specialist with proprietary operational knowledge.

Which cities in Oklahoma have the most operations specialist sponsorship jobs?

Tulsa and Oklahoma City account for the large majority of operations specialist sponsorship activity in Oklahoma. Tulsa's energy and aerospace industries generate consistent demand for operations coordination roles. Oklahoma City sees sponsorship from corporate employers in energy, healthcare administration, and technology services. Smaller cities like Broken Arrow, adjacent to Tulsa, also have manufacturing and distribution employers that occasionally sponsor operations roles.

Are there state-specific considerations for operations specialist sponsorship in Oklahoma?

Oklahoma's economy is heavily weighted toward energy, aerospace, and agriculture, so operations specialist roles often require industry-specific knowledge in those sectors. Employers filing H-1B petitions must pay the Department of Labor prevailing wage for the specific occupation and geographic area, which in Oklahoma is generally benchmarked against Tulsa and Oklahoma City metropolitan data. University of Oklahoma and Oklahoma State University both produce operations and supply chain graduates, creating local pipelines that some employers draw from alongside international candidates.

What is the prevailing wage for sponsored operations specialist jobs in Oklahoma?

U.S. employers sponsoring a visa must pay at least the prevailing wage, which is what workers in the same role, area, and experience level typically earn. The Department of Labor sets this rate to make sure companies aren't hiring foreign workers simply because they'd accept lower pay than a U.S. worker. It varies by job title, location, and experience. You can look up current prevailing wage rates for any occupation and location using the OFLC Wage Search page.
